"Aslin's 211-seat indoor/outdoor beer garden on 14th Street in Logan Circle serves 21 Aslin draft beers including fan favorites and new releases, as well as two rotating taps of guest beers from our friends around the country. Aslin DC is also the location of the very first Aslin Coffee bar. Aslin Coffee serves traditional espresso beverages, house-made flavorings, pour overs, and teas."

"This indoor-outdoor beer garden in Logan Circle fits right in with the all-day party that is 14th Street. Aslin Beer Company, which also has locations in Virginia and Pennsylvania, is the place to go when you’re hoping to catch a glimpse of last weekend’s missed connection or the occasional DC celebrity. You can pass the time by trying one of their housemade beers, like their Stating the Obvious, a bitter-hoppy balanced Vienna-style lager, and a range of sours that stay in steady rotation (they keep as many as 20 on draught). "After months of anticipation, Aslin Beer Company kicked open the sleek wooden gates to its Logan Circle hangout over Independence Day weekend. The Northern Virginia cult-favorite brewery took over a former fueling station sitting on prime 14th Street real estate and turned it into a colorful 211-seat taproom and beer garden. The space also includes Aslin Coffee, the very first coffee shop of its kind." - Adele Chapin
